Rebecca Henseler currently serves as the Director of Emergency Planning and Resiliency at the Metropolitan Transportation Authority, a position held since September 2022. Prior to this role, Rebecca was the Deputy Director at the New York City Housing Authority from August 2020 to September 2022. Between April 2015 and August 2020, Rebecca worked as the Director of Chemical, Biological, Radiological, and Nuclear (CBRN) Emergency Planning at the NYC Department of Health and Mental Hygiene. Rebecca Henseler holds a Master of Public Health (MPH) degree in Epidemiology from Columbia University.

The Metropolitan Transportation Authority is North America's largest transportation network, serving a population of 15.3 million people in the 5,000-square-mile area fanning out from New York City through Long Island, southeastern New York State, and Connecticut. The MTA comprises six agencies: MTA New York City Transit, MTA Bus Company, MTA Long Island Rail Road, MTA Metro-North Railroad, MTA Bridges and Tunnels, and MTA Construction & Development.
